Property tax deferral program-amendments.
HB 121 modifies Wyoming's property tax deferral program to help homeowners with primary residences on parcels ≤40 acres. It caps deferred taxes at 50% of annual real estate taxes, sets interest rates at 4% compounded annually (or treasury-based for specific cases), and requires the Department of Revenue to confirm funding availability before approving deferrals. Eligibility now requires annual financial status verification, and deferred taxes become due immediately if property value exceeds 50% of the property's fair market value. The bill also mandates county rulemaking, public outreach, and annual reporting to the Department of Revenue.
